Indian Journal of Chemical Technology, Vol.18, No.3, 234-243, 2011
Homogeneous grafting of PMMA onto cellulose in presence of Ce4+ as initiator
Poly (methyl methacrylate) (PMMA) is successfully grafted onto cellulose in homogeneous medium in N,N-dimethyl acetamide/LiCl solvent system. The method is based upon ring opening reaction of cellulose with Ce4+ ion. Ceric ammonium nitrate (CAN) forms free radical on cellulose back bone in presence of DMSO via ring opening mechanism and PMMA is grafted through homogeneous breaking of the acrylic double bond. Methylene blue was used as an inhibitor to check the formation of homopolymer. The graft yield and grafting efficiency was studied by varying reaction time, temperature, and monomer concentration. The products are characterized by FTIR and H-1-NMR analysis and a possible reaction mechanism is deduced. Thermal degradation of the grafted products is also studied by thermo-gravimetric analysis (TG).
